










TE ANAU
Todays woody the 28’ Brin Wilson designed and built (1966) launch.
An absence of varnished timber equals a vessel that is easily maintained by the DIY boaty. When and if you got the urge to pimp her a little, some varnished trim e.g. grab rails, would really make Te Anau standout.
Built from kauri, a reconditioned Ford 100hp diesel gives Te Anau a comfortable cruising speed of 7.5 knots. An inspection showed her structure was sound but needed some refinishing inside and out.
14-09-2023 UPDATE – Te Anau is back in the water having had the following done work done – photos below
- scrape, sand, primed and antifoul (2 coats)
- diesel engine services (oil change, oil filter, diesel filter)
- new zinc anode
- propspeed
